The blue iguana was on the brink of extinction in the Cayman
Islands which is a British overseas territory. I am pleased to say
that that risk of extinction has now passed, with the support of
many hon. Members. I pay tribute to the Government of the Cayman
Islands for their work in ensuring that the wonderful blue iguana
species continues to survive and thrive there. To read the whole
